I had a similar problem with stacks of 3750X switches. The master would finish booting to 15.2(4)E5 but the slaves would not. They would get to the point where they should ask the master for config, and then after a few minutes would reboot again. The console indicated that vstack had been turned on even though we turned it off for all our devices. After trying to troubleshoot for a few hours we had to separate all the stack members, individually boot them, downgrade them to 15.2(4)E4, shut everything down, reboot the master into 15.2(4)E4, then reattach the stacking cables and power the slaves up in numeric order. Shortly they all returned to service. Fixing this for three stacks was an 8 hour chore.
I don't know what's wrong with 15.2(4)E5 but there is no way in the world I would use it again on a C3750X stack.
12-14-2018 11:19 AM
The official answer to my inquiry was that this version of IOS was incompatible with VTP. We would have to use transparent mode for VTP. That wasn't acceptable to us, so we waited until the bug had been fixed in 15.2(4)E7 to finish the upgrade.
